基于log4net日志组件的使用
一、前言
系统运行的时候,生产上需要使用文件来记录一些系统运行中的日志,比如系统的对接日志、错误信息、警告信息或者特定调试信息,通过对记录的信息回溯系统执行过程,查找系统问题,帮助开发者解决线上问题等。这个系统都要使用日志组件,一般都会有相应的开源组件,比如log4net。
二、使用
1、在项目引用中引入log4net组件,然后对日志配置文件进行配置,配置信息涉及到文件夹位置、文件名称格式、文件最大大小、文件的内容格式、日志级别等信息,比如Log4Net.config。
<?xml version="1.0" encoding="utf-8" ?> <configuration> <configSections> <section name="log4net" type="log4net.Config.Log4NetConfigurationSectionHandler, log4net"/> configSections> <log4net> <appender name="ConsoleAppender" type="log4net.Appender.ConsoleAppender"> <layout type="log4net.Layout.PatternLayout"> <conversionPattern value="[%p %t] [%date{yyyy-MM-dd HH:mm:ss,fff}] %-5l - %m%n"/> layout> appender> <appender name="RollingLogFileAppender" type="log4net.Appender.RollingFileAppender"> <param name= "File" value= "logs\Info\log_"/> <param name= "AppendToFile" value= "true"/> <param name= "MaxSizeRollBackups" value= "10"/> <param name= "StaticLogFileName" value= "false"/> <param name= "DatePattern" value= "yyyy-MM-dd".log""/> <param name= "RollingStyle" value= "Date"/> <layout type="log4net.Layout.PatternLayout"> <conversionPattern value="记录时间:%date 线程ID:[%thread] 日志级别: %-5level 类:%logger - 描述:%message %n"/> layout> <filter type="log4net.Filter.LevelRangeFilter"> <param name="LevelMin" value="Info" /> <param name="LevelMax" value="WARN" /> filter> appender> <appender name="RollingFile" type="log4net.Appender.RollingFileAppender"> <param name= "File" value= "logs\Error\Log_"/> <param name= "AppendToFile" value= "true"/> <param name= "MaxSizeRollBackups" value= "10"/> <param name= "StaticLogFileName" value= "false"/> <param name= "DatePattern" value= "yyyy-MM-dd".log""/> <param name= "RollingStyle" value= "Date"/> <layout type="log4net.Layout.PatternLayout"> <conversionPattern value="记录时间:%date 线程ID:[%thread] 日志级别: %-5level 类:%logger - 描述:%message %n"/> layout> <filter type="log4net.Filter.LevelRangeFilter"> <param name="LevelMin" value="ERROR" /> <param name="LevelMax" value="FATAL" /> filter> appender> <root> <level value="ALL" /> <appender-ref ref="RollingLogFileAppender" /> <appender-ref ref="RollingFile" /> root> log4net> configuration>
通过这个日志文件定义基本信息,可以在打印日志生成想要的日志文件。
2、在项目代码中使用配置文件,并且提供写入日志的方法,定义一个日志接口(使用文件或者数据库的方式),通过log4net组件来实现文件形式记录日志信息。
using System; using System.Collections.Generic; using System.Linq; using System.Text; using System.Threading.Tasks; namespace TQF.Logger.Logger { ////// 定义日志接口类 /// public interface ILogger { /// /// 调试日志输出 /// /// 输出内容 void Debug(string msg); /// /// 调试日志输出 /// /// 输出内容 /// 输出异常 void Debug(string msg, Exception ex); /// /// 信息日志输出 /// /// 输出内容 void Info(string msg); /// /// 信息日志输出 /// /// 输出内容 /// 输出异常 void Info(string msg, Exception ex); /// /// 警告日志输出 /// /// 输出内容 void Warn(string msg); /// /// 警告日志输出 /// /// 输出内容 /// 输出异常 void Warn(string msg, Exception ex); /// /// 错误日志输出 /// /// 输出内容 void Error(string msg); /// /// 错误日志输出 /// /// 输出内容 /// 输出异常 void Error(string msg, Exception ex); /// /// 致命日志输出 /// /// 输出内容 void Fatal(string msg); /// /// 致命日志输出 /// /// 输出内容 /// 输出异常 void Fatal(string msg, Exception ex); } }
using System; using System.Collections.Generic; using System.IO; using System.Linq; using System.Text; using System.Threading.Tasks; using log4net; using log4net.Appender; using log4net.Config; namespace TQF.Logger.Logger { ////// 日志接口实现类 /// public class Log4Helper : ILogger { /// /// 考虑使用线程安全的字典 /// private Dictionary<string, ILog> LogDic = new Dictionary<string, ILog>(); /// /// 定义锁对象 /// private object _islock = new object(); /// /// 定义文件名 /// private string fileName = string.Empty; /// /// 使用构造函数日志调用初始化 /// /// 日志文件保存路径[若路径为空,则默认程序根目录Logger文件夹;] /// 日志文件名[若文件名为空,则默认文件名:Default] public Log4Helper(string fileSavePath, string fileName, string logSuffix = ".log") { try { Init(); if (string.IsNullOrEmpty(fileSavePath)) fileSavePath = "Logger"; if (string.IsNullOrEmpty(fileName)) fileName = "Default"; this.fileName = fileName; var repository = LogManager.GetRepository(); var appenders = repository.GetAppenders(); if (appenders.Length == 0) return; var targetApder = appenders.First(p => p.Name == "FileInfoAppender") as RollingFileAppender; targetApder.File = Path.Combine(fileSavePath, this.fileName + logSuffix); targetApder.ActivateOptions(); } catch (Exception ex) { } } /// /// 缓存日志对象(通过日志文件名缓存日志对象,减少日志对象的创建工作) /// /// /// private ILog GetLog(string name) { try { if (LogDic == null) { LogDic = new Dictionary<string, ILog>(); } lock (_islock) { if (!LogDic.ContainsKey(name)) { LogDic.Add(name, LogManager.GetLogger(name)); } } return LogDic[name]; } catch { return LogManager.GetLogger("Default"); } } /// /// 日志记录初始化 /// private void Init() { // 获取日志配置文件 var file = new FileInfo(Path.Combine(AppDomain.CurrentDomain.BaseDirectory, "Log4net.config")); // 检测配置文件是否存在 if (file.Exists) { //加载配置文件 XmlConfigurator.Configure(file); } else { new Exception("找不到日志配置文件!"); } } /// /// 调试日志输出 /// /// 内容 public void Debug(string msg) { var log = GetLog(this.fileName); if (log == null) { return; } log.Debug(msg); } /// /// 调试日志输出 /// /// 输出内容 /// 输出异常 public void Debug(string msg, Exception ex) { var log = GetLog(this.fileName); if (log == null) { return; } log.Debug(msg, ex); } /// /// 错误日志输出 /// /// 输出内容 public void Error(string msg) { var log = GetLog(this.fileName); if (log == null) { return; } log.Error(msg); } /// /// 错误日志输出 /// /// 输出内容 /// 输出异常 public void Error(string msg, Exception ex) { var log = GetLog(this.fileName); if (log == null) { return; } log.Error(msg, ex); } /// /// 致命日志输出 /// /// 输出内容 public void Fatal(string msg) { var log = GetLog(this.fileName); if (log == null) { return; } log.Fatal(msg); } /// /// 致命日志输出 /// /// 输出内容 /// 输出异常 public void Fatal(string msg, Exception ex) { var log = GetLog(this.fileName); if (log == null) { return; } log.Fatal(msg, ex); } /// /// 信息日志输出 /// /// 输出内容 public void Info(string msg) { var log = GetLog(this.fileName); if (log == null) { return; } log.Info(msg); } /// /// 信息日志输出 /// /// 输出内容 /// 输出异常 public void Info(string msg, Exception ex) { var log = GetLog(this.fileName); if (log == null) { return; } log.Info(msg, ex); } /// /// 警告日志输出 /// /// 输出内容 public void Warn(string msg) { var log = GetLog(this.fileName); if (log == null) { return; } log.Warn(msg); } /// /// 警告日志输出 /// /// 输出内容 /// 输出异常 public void Warn(string msg, Exception ex) { var log = GetLog(this.fileName); if (log == null) { return; } log.Warn(msg, ex); } } }
using System; using System.Collections.Generic; using System.Linq; using System.Text; using System.Threading.Tasks; using TQF.Logger.Logger; namespace TQF.Logger { ////// 配置文件如果不设置属性“复制到输出目录”不会在debug文件中存在 /// class Program { static void Main(string[] args) { var log4Helper = new Log4Helper(string.Empty, "program"); log4Helper.Info("info"); } } }
通过上述代码,定义日志接口(写入方法,不同层级的写入方法)、日志帮助类实现接口,使用组件读取配置文件、获取日志对象写入日志。
3、上述是按照配置文件格式定义好的文件夹、文件名称、文件内容格式,相对标准化,如果系统要特殊的记录单个日志信息,比如不确定文件夹名称、不确定的的文件名称等,就要开发者进行自定义。
using System; using System.Collections.Generic; using System.Linq; using System.Text; using System.Collections.Concurrent; using System.Configuration; using log4net; using log4net.Appender; using log4net.Core; using log4net.Layout; using log4net.Repository; using log4net.Repository.Hierarchy; [assembly: log4net.Config.XmlConfigurator(Watch = true)] namespace DataPullAPI.Utility { ////// log4net 自定义日志类 /// public static class LogCustomHelper { /// /// 类型安全的字典对象 /// private static readonly ConcurrentDictionary<string, ILog> loggerContainer = new ConcurrentDictionary<string, ILog>(); //默认配置 private const int MAX_SIZE_ROLL_BACKUPS = 20; private const string LAYOUT_PATTERN = "%message"; private const string DATE_PATTERN = "yyyyMMdd"; private const string MAXIMUM_FILE_SIZE = "10MB"; private const string LEVEL = "ALL"; /// /// 获取日志对象 /// /// /// /// /// public static ILog GetCustomLogger(string loggerName, string category = null, bool additivity = false) { return loggerContainer.GetOrAdd(loggerName, delegate (string name) { RollingFileAppender newAppender = GetNewFileApender(loggerName, GetFile(category, loggerName), MAX_SIZE_ROLL_BACKUPS, true, true, MAXIMUM_FILE_SIZE, RollingFileAppender.RollingMode.Composite, DATE_PATTERN, LAYOUT_PATTERN); Hierarchy repository = (Hierarchy)LogManager.GetRepository(); Logger logger = repository.LoggerFactory.CreateLogger(repository, loggerName); logger.Hierarchy = repository; logger.Parent = repository.Root; logger.Level = GetLoggerLevel(LEVEL); logger.Additivity = additivity; logger.AddAppender(newAppender); logger.Repository.Configured = true; return new LogImpl(logger); }); } /// /// 自定日志文件夹和文件路径 /// /// /// /// private static string GetFile(string category, string loggerName) { if (string.IsNullOrEmpty(category)) { return string.Format(@"Logs\{0}\{1}.txt", DateTime.Now.ToString("yyyy-MM-dd"), loggerName); } else { return string.Format(@"Logs\{0}\{1}\{2}.txt", category,DateTime.Now.ToString("yyyy-MM-dd"), loggerName); } } /// /// 获取日志级别 /// /// /// private static Level GetLoggerLevel(string level) { if (!string.IsNullOrEmpty(level)) { switch (level.ToLower().Trim()) { case "debug": return Level.Debug; case "info": return Level.Info; case "warn": return Level.Warn; case "error": return Level.Error; case "fatal": return Level.Fatal; } } return Level.Debug; } /// /// 获取配置信息 /// /// /// /// /// /// /// /// /// /// /// private static RollingFileAppender GetNewFileApender(string appenderName, string file, int maxSizeRollBackups, bool appendToFile = true, bool staticLogFileName = false, string maximumFileSize = "2MB", RollingFileAppender.RollingMode rollingMode = RollingFileAppender.RollingMode.Size, string datePattern = "yyyyMMdd\".txt\"", string layoutPattern = "%d [%t] %-5p %c - %m%n") { RollingFileAppender appender = new RollingFileAppender { LockingModel = new FileAppender.MinimalLock(), Name = appenderName, File = file, AppendToFile = appendToFile, MaxSizeRollBackups = maxSizeRollBackups, MaximumFileSize = maximumFileSize, StaticLogFileName = staticLogFileName, RollingStyle = rollingMode, DatePattern = datePattern }; PatternLayout layout = new PatternLayout(layoutPattern); appender.Layout = layout; layout.ActivateOptions(); appender.ActivateOptions(); return appender; } /// /// 写入日志信息 /// /// 文件夹名称 /// 文件名称 /// 日志信息 public static void Info(string folderName, string fileName,string message) { ILog logger = GetCustomLogger(fileName, folderName); logger.Info(message); } } }
通过在写入日志的时候,传入文件夹和文件名称来自定义日志存储,对于特殊的日志信息可以通过该方法达到特定存储要求。
总结
1、在系统生产环境记录日志可以帮助用户定位系统问题,解决系统问题,对系统执行过程中可能出现异常错误进行捕获记录,对执行全过程进行回溯查看等。
2、系统日志不仅可以使用文件方式进行存储,还可以使用数据库的方式进行存储。
